This tender and juicy air fryer filet mignon cooks up in under 15 minutes and requires minimal prep! Serve it with your favorite sides for the perfect quick and easy meal.
Allow steaks to sit out of the fridge for about 15-20 minutes to get to room temperature before cooking.
Make garlic butter, if using, by combining softened butter with garlic, parsley and salt. Mash the mixture together until combined. Set aside.
Combine salt, pepper, garlic and onion powder and thyme in a small bowl. Rub seasonings on all sides of the steak.
Spray air fryer basket with avocado oil and preheat to 400° F.
Place steak into your air fryer basket and cook until the steaks have reached your desired level of doneness. You can use a meat thermometer to ensure the right temperature. We prefer medium steaks (with an internal temp of 140°F) and cook the steaks for 6 minutes, flip then cook for an additional 6 minutes. If you prefer medium-rare, cook the steaks for less time and for a more well done steam, add some additional time.
After cooking, allow steak to rest before cutting, about 5 minutes. Top with a pat of garlic butter, if desired and enjoy.

Air Fryer Filet Mignon Doneness Guide at 400°F
Rare
Time: 6-8 minutes
Internal Temp: 120°F - 125°F
Medium Rare
Time: 8-10 minutes
Internal Temp: 130°F - 135°F
Medium
Time: 10-12 minutes
Internal Temp: 140°F - 145°F
Medium Well
Time: 12-14 minutes
Internal Temp: 150°F - 155°F
Well Done
Time: 14-16 minutes
Internal Temp: 160°F and above
These times are based on a 1.5-inch thick filet. If the steak is thicker or thinner, adjust by 1-2 minutes accordingly.
Resting: Let the steak rest for 5 minutes after air frying to allow juices to redistribute and for the temperature to rise slightly.
Thermometer: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ature, aiming for slightly under your target, as the steak will continue to cook slightly while resting.
